Output d3bbfec35cc6b7668d9c5fb58a1aad4e4e1ca9f20ae8df1107852465ab77d896:0

value
100136
script pubkey
OP_0 OP_PUSHBYTES_20 3aeae24e60b0b9829820198c0c48ad937076326b
address
bc1q8t4wynnqkzuc9xpqrxxqcj9djdc8vvntsu7qta
transaction
d3bbfec35cc6b7668d9c5fb58a1aad4e4e1ca9f20ae8df1107852465ab77d896
confirmations
191361
spent
true